1 LIFT FORCE FOR VARIOUS GEOMETRIES


Lift force generated by the wind is responsible for the rotation of the wind turbine blades. So the lift force
developed on the wing due to the wind is calculated and compared for various sections using fluent.

Table 4.1Diffuser geometry optimization at various wind speeds

LIFT FORCE(N)
WIND BARE
SPEED(m/s) TURBINE 2000 2500 3000 3500 4000 4500 5000
1 16 17 22 15 4 13 13 16
2 65 70 88 54 20 53 53 68
3 145 140 208 134 50 131 131 155
4 262 212 369 220 64 209 210 276
5 411 416 559 347 151 346 344 430
6 594 589 771 525 192 502 497 628
7 789 820 1059 710 259 636 674 870
8 1008 1063 1466 892 356 880 913 1113
9 1287 1357 1844 1117 474 1086 1101 1423
10 1581 1607 2325 1418 517 1370 1343 1757
11 1902 2096 2734 1722 751 1607 1569 2081
12 2397 3440 3294 1966 742 1879 1833 2508
13 2712 4013 3901 2500 921 2198 2202 2880
14 3187 4585 4558 2799 1167 2573 2470 3402
15 3769 5400 5188 3107 1168 3043 2991 4030

4.4 FINAL COMPARISON
Thus the results obtained from the above graphs are compared in the following tabulation.

Table 4.4Final comparison of bare turbine vs diffuser with/without brim

LIFT FORCE (N)


DIFFUSER DIFFUSER WITH
WIND SPEED (m/s) WITHOUT BRIM BRIM BARE TURBINE
1 22 24 16
2 88 96 65
3 208 218 145
4 369 392 262
5 559 601 411
6 771 860 594
7 1059 1193 789
8 1466 1518 1008
9 1844 1917 1287
10 2325 2472 1581
11 2734 2892 1902
12 3294 3436 2397
13 3901 3982 2712
14 4558 4707 3187
15 5188 5435 3769
